"I was just concerned about getting pregnant": Attitudes toward pregnancy and contraceptive use among adolescent girls and young women in Thika, Kenya.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

Adolescent girls and young women (AGYW) have a high incidence of unplanned pregnancies, especially in low-resource settings. AGYW assess the overlapping risks of pregnancy, contraception, and STIs as they navigate relationships. Few studies have examined how AGYW consider the comparative risks of their decisions around sexual and reproductive health in this context or how risk perception influences contraceptive use.

METHODS

Twenty in-depth interviews (IDIs) and 5 focus group discussions (FGDs) were conducted with a subset of sexually active AGYW enrolled in the Girls Health Study (GHS), a longitudinal cohort study in Thika, Kenya, assessing HSV-2 incidence in a cohort of AGYW aged 16-20. Interview questions were focused on perspectives and decision-making around sexual and reproductive health. Interviews were conducted in both English and Kiswahili, transcribed, and coded using inductive and deductive approaches to identify emerging themes.

RESULTS

Misconceptions about long-acting reversible contraceptives (LARCs), injectables, and daily oral contraceptive pills strongly disincentivized their use among AGYW. Participants described pregnancy as undesirable, and AGYW reported prioritizing contraceptive methods that were effective and reliable in pregnancy prevention, even if not effective in preventing STI/HIV infection. Participants reported that AGYW relied heavily on emergency contraceptive (EC) pills for pregnancy prevention.

CONCLUSIONS

Though the goal of avoiding unintended pregnancy was common, this did not suffice to motivate the uptake of long-term contraceptives among AGYWs. Given the convenience, cost-effectiveness, and lower perceived risk of side effects, EC pills were more likely to be accepted as a form of contraception. Understanding the reasons for AGYW's acceptance of certain contraceptive methods over others can help future interventions better target communication and counseling about contraception and influence key drivers of AGYW behavior and decision-making around sexual and reproductive health.

摘要

背景

青少年女孩和年轻女性(AGYW)意外怀孕的发生率很高,尤其是在资源匮乏的环境中。AGYW 在处理人际关系时,会评估怀孕、避孕和性传播感染(STI)的重叠风险。很少有研究探讨 AGYW 如何考虑在这种情况下他们在性和生殖健康方面的决策的相对风险,以及风险感知如何影响避孕措施的使用。

方法

对参加肯尼亚蒂卡 Girls Health Study(GHS)的一部分性活跃的 AGYW 进行了 20 次深入访谈(IDIs)和 5 次焦点小组讨论(FGDs),该纵向队列研究评估了 16-20 岁 AGYW 中单纯疱疹病毒 2 型(HSV-2)的发病率。访谈问题集中在性和生殖健康方面的观点和决策。访谈以英语和斯瓦希里语进行,采用归纳和演绎方法进行转录和编码,以确定新兴主题。

结果

对长效可逆避孕方法(LARCs)、注射剂和每日口服避孕药的误解强烈阻碍了 AGYW 使用这些方法。参与者将怀孕描述为不可取的,AGYW 报告优先选择对怀孕预防有效的和可靠的避孕方法,即使这些方法对预防性传播感染/艾滋病毒感染无效。参与者报告说,AGYW 严重依赖紧急避孕药(EC)来预防怀孕。

结论

尽管避免意外怀孕的目标是共同的,但这不足以促使 AGYW 采用长期避孕方法。鉴于 EC 药片的便利性、成本效益和较低的副作用风险感知,它们更有可能被接受为一种避孕方法。了解 AGYW 接受某些避孕方法而不是其他方法的原因,可以帮助未来的干预措施更好地针对避孕方面的沟通和咨询,并影响 AGYW 性行为和生殖健康决策的关键驱动因素。
